The Tower-of-Babel Problem, and Security Assesment Sharing
Andreas Blass, Yuri Gurevich, Efim Hudis, The Logic in Computer Science Column, by Y. Gurevich
Abstract
The tower-of-Babel problem is rather general: How to enable a collaboration
among experts speaking different languages? A computer security
version of the tower-of-Babel problem is rather important. A recent Microsoft
solution for that security problem, called Security Assessment Sharing,
is based on this idea: A tiny common language goes a long way. We
construct simple mathematical models showing that the idea is sound.
